以文本方式查看主题 - Foxtable(狐表) (http://foxtable.com/bbs/index.asp) -- 专家坐堂 (http://foxtable.com/bbs/list.asp?boardid=2) ---- [求助]这段excel报表代码有问题嘛?(老大在线,请教) (http://foxtable.com/bbs/dispbbs.asp?boardid=2&id=16741) |
||||
-- 作者:gaoyong30000 -- 发布时间:2012/2/22 14:37:00 -- [求助]这段excel报表代码有问题嘛?(老大在线,请教) 这代码是在excel报表模板里的一个单元格 <int([库存时间]) & "月" & MID([库存时间]-INT([库存时间]),3,99) & "天">
红色部分 是为了计算出小数点后面的数值
例如:库存时间 = 3.13 红色部分就会算出13
现在问题是 在报表相应的位置 显示不出数值来 [此贴子已经被作者于2012-2-22 14:51:51编辑过]
|
||||
-- 作者:狐狸爸爸 -- 发布时间:2012/2/22 14:52:00 -- ([库存时间]-INT([库存时间])) * 100 |
||||
-- 作者:gaoyong30000 -- 发布时间:2012/2/22 15:00:00 -- 好像没用
<int([库存时间]) & "月" & ([库存时间]-INT([库存时间]))*100 & "天">
还是空值~~ [此贴子已经被作者于2012-2-22 15:00:20编辑过]
|
||||
-- 作者:gaoyong30000 -- 发布时间:2012/2/22 15:02:00 --
附上excel报表模板 |
||||
-- 作者:狐狸爸爸 -- 发布时间:2012/2/22 15:03:00 -- 我在命令窗口测试有效:
Return Eval("(3.33-INT(3.33)) * 100") |
||||
-- 作者:gaoyong30000 -- 发布时间:2012/2/22 15:05:00 -- 公式在 表的 库存时间 右边 |
||||
-- 作者:gaoyong30000 -- 发布时间:2012/2/22 15:09:00 -- 我测试也有效果 但是就是出不来~ |
||||
-- 作者:狐狸爸爸 -- 发布时间:2012/2/22 15:13:00 --
|
||||
-- 作者:gaoyong30000 -- 发布时间:2012/2/22 15:26:00 -- 有点见鬼哎
我原来这个公式没有问题 用新公式就有问题
<int([库存时间]) & "月" & right([库存时间],2) & "天" > [此贴子已经被作者于2012-2-22 15:26:05编辑过]
|
||||
-- 作者:gaoyong30000 -- 发布时间:2012/2/22 15:30:00 -- 晕 用了老大您的测试的例子里的代码过去 就没问题了 然道是全角半角 “”的问题? |